Output f7ea3675e71017614cc354ebb76243d05798434a5a9fc52e875cc5c52d51c4a9:13

value
12869315
script pubkey
OP_0 OP_PUSHBYTES_20 366c23abeb46ebcc4fde50a0aa148975d9541229
address
bc1qxekz82ltgm4ucn772zs259yfwhv4gy3fk2tfta
transaction
f7ea3675e71017614cc354ebb76243d05798434a5a9fc52e875cc5c52d51c4a9
spent
true